Output 8b0596697a069235e89114ce29a67e4a7ab2cd587553e70c13d4433c3729a8ae:2

value
1426415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94af2f96ab434055a22217ef455aec6351875f9f OP_EQUAL
address
3FFBo4f8yjjsQrXMzoXHnASmcFXZfRTrWq
transaction
8b0596697a069235e89114ce29a67e4a7ab2cd587553e70c13d4433c3729a8ae
spent
true